On Sat, Jan 3, 2009 at 12:52 AM, Jakub Jelinek <jakub@redhat.com> wrote:
> Hi!
>
> If one of the vars whose address is passed to memcpy is e.g. const
> qualified, we shouldn't attempt to write through say *(const int *)ptr.
> Similarly for restrict, for volatile we IMHO just don't want to optimize.
>
> Fixed thusly, bootstrapped/regtested on x86_64-linux. Ok for trunk?
While I don't see a reason for restricting this for volatile I don't feel strong
about this either (people cannot expect volatile semantics from calling
memcpy with volatile pointers anyway).
So, this is ok with or without the volatile restriction.
Thanks,
Richard.
> 2009-01-03 Jakub Jelinek <jakub@redhat.com>
>
> PR c++/38705
> * builtins.c (fold_builtin_memory_op): Give up if either operand
> is volatile. Set srctype or desttype to non-qualified version
> of the other type.
>
> * g++.dg/torture/pr38705.C: New test.
